Set in the early 19th century, the narrative follows Walter Hartright, a drawing teacher in love with his student, Laura Fairlie. Unable to marry her, Laura is forced into a marriage with the scheming Sir Percival Glyde, who, alongside the cunning Count Fosco, devises a plan to access her fortune by faking her death and confining her to a mental asylum. The story unfolds as Hartright, aided by Laura's determined half-sister Marian Halcombe, works to unravel their deceit and rescue Laura from her grim fate.
